  Donnel said
  " I agree that sewing my first garb was a right of passage. Also I believe that they need to invest in the SCA and garb to want to come back and play. This way we are enableling them to be successful but not doing it for them. They still have to put time and effort into the activity. "
   
  Katheryn - And actually this is what I have been doing and I think it is working out ok. There have been a few folks that we have taught some beginning sewing.  I think it enriched both of their lives.  When you show them that it is not difficult to make a piece of garb, it does empower them to explore further.
